TWO factories on the outskirts of Durham have been damaged by fire.
The factory units, which are both in Langley Moor, were hit by separate fires just hours apart.
A small factory on Towngate Business Centre was the first to be damaged. Fire crews were called to the scene at 7.20pm on Monday.
The building, which contained an articulated lorry, suffered an estimated 200,000-worth of damage.
The lorry was destroyed, ten per cent of the roof was wrecked and the rest of the unit was damaged by heat and smoke.
Just hours later, a second fire broke out at the Interfloor factory, on nearby Littleburn Industrial Estate.
Firefighters were alerted at around 1.40pm on Tuesday and contained the fire in a silo.
A spokesman for Durham Fire and Rescue Service said the first fire could have been caused by an electrical fault or a fuel leak and the second is being treated as an accident.
